Method
To Make Lamb
To Serve
1
Mix all the marinade ingredients in a small bowl to combine.
2
Place the lamb ribs in a resealable bag or plastic container and add the marinade, mixing well to coat then cover.
3
Leave to marinate for at least an hour or overnight in the fridge.
Start Timer
4
Remove the ribs from the fridge at least 30 minutes before cooking and season.
Start Timer
5
Preheat a barbecue grill or frying pan to a medium-high heat.
6
Add the ribs and cook until browned and crunchy on all sides – around 15-20 minutes.
Start Timer
7
If you have single ribs they will only take about 10-15 minutes.
